          The rotten truth of banking on buried savings

          By Jia Xu (chinadaily.com.cn)

          A damaged 100-yuan note Li buried underground one year ago is shown on May 20 in Luxiang county in Changchun, capital of Northeast China's Jilin province. [Photo/CFP]

          Like many people his age, 75-year-old Li was fearful of banks.

          So when the farmer from Luxiang county in Changchun, capital of Northeast China's Jilin province had to move from his home to find work in the city, he buried his hard-earned 10,000 yuan savings ($1,540) in the backyard.

          He had saved the money for over 10-years from painstakingly planting crops in his remote village and had carried the cash in a secret pocket in his underwear for eight years before burying it in 2010.

          Li holds the damaged cash which he buried underground one year ago in Luxiang county in Changchun, capital of Northeast China's Jilin province. [Photo/CFP]

          But when Li returned to dig up the cash on May 20, he was left speechless and in tears after discovering his savings had literally rotted away.

          "Every penny I earned came out of intense labor work," said Li adding the fact that he was also unmarried.

          Out of 10,000 yuan only 6,300 remained in complete shape, others were either torn apart or completely damaged by the soil. Bank staff suggested he bought Scotch tape to stick the ripped parts back together again in a final attempt to salvage some of his money.

          Luckily Li redeemed 9,050 yuan by exchanging the old notes for new at his local Industrial and Commercial Bank of China (ICBC), local media reported.

          Damaged 100-yuan notes Li buried underground one year ago is shown on May 20 in Luxiang county in Changchun, capital of Northeast China's Jilin province. [Photo/CFP]

          "The elderly still hold the view of not troubling the bank when it comes to saving money, they like to have the cash in their sight," said Wang, vice director of ICBC Changchun branch, who helped Li with the exchange.

          "I would never save money in a secret underground. The bank is the safest place," Li said.
